Tamra Lynn Smith
Surprise Arizona
Tamra Lynn Smith is the founder of Project Troops & a (then Blue Star Army Mom.) She started Project Troops when her son was serving in the army and stationed in Iraq in 2007. It all started quite by accident with the first song that she wrote for her son and just kept getting bigger and bigger on its own. Military affilitaed people started hearing the songs and they started joining her groups. Before she realized it, there were thousands of military friends following her music. She has had 11 Top 30 indie chart hit songs since 2008. Project Troops started because of one mother who was trying to protect her son from the military and its unfair acts of discharging military members who suffer from PTSD and other mood disorders.

Tamra was an OTR Truck driver for 8 years until she was injured & was forced to medically retire in 2008. She drove a million miles without an accident across the USA. Tamra has been in every state in America.
